    Hi you have yourself a 4.5 inch shell case. In ww2 they were used as anti aircraft and they were also used as a naval gun round. They were used widly by the british and a few other nato members. If i have this the right way round if it in naval it will have an electric primer and if it is a land gun it will have a primer with a cap in like a pistol/rifle round.
    hope this helps.
